What is a content moderator?

Content Moderators are professionals responsible for reviewing and monitoring user-generated content on websites, social media platforms, and forums to ensure it complies with community guidelines and legal requirements. They evaluate text, images, videos, and other media for inappropriate, offensive, or harmful material, removing or reporting content that violates policies. Content Moderators play a crucial role in maintaining safe and respectful online environments, often working in teams and using specialized tools or software. Their work helps prevent the spread of misinformation, hate speech, and other problematic content online.

What are some common challenges faced by content moderators, and how can they be managed effectively?

Content moderation often involves reviewing large volumes of user-generated content, some of which may be graphic or emotionally challenging. This can lead to stress or fatigue, so employers typically offer mental health support and regular breaks to help moderators manage. Additionally, content moderators work closely with clear guidelines and escalation procedures to ensure consistent decisions and support from team leads. Building resilience and using available resources are key to thriving in this role.

Zenith is one of Publicis Groupe's largest media agencies, spanning 95 markets globally with US offices in New York, Burbank, Chicago, Atlanta and Detroit. For more than 30 years, we have been at the forefront of media, helping to evolve and reshape the industry. We are highly regarded as a true agency partner by many high-profile brands for our expertise across numerous categories and wide range of capabilities that are unparalleled in the industry. Clients hire us for our track record of excellence in strategic planning, investment, and measurement. We also have specialist offerings, including content, commerce, multicultural and future-proofed data capabilities.
Overview
The Supervisor of Content partners closely with Client and agency strategy and investment teams to ideate, develop, negotiate, and complete campaigns for our clients across platforms. Passionate about developing media partnerships focused on meaningful engagement, production partner collaborations, and creator marketing. The Supervisor is experienced in content and knowledgeable across media fields.
Responsibilities
  • Focused on direct activation with digital and content publishers, contributing to drive creativity, ideation, and innovation that leads to ownable consumer engagement opportunities in the content and digital space.
  • Partner with teams to develop and complete customized composed marketing solutions, driving return on investment for the brands based on their specific objectives.
    • Provide strategic input based on audience insights, performance analysis and familiarity with the marketplace throughout content and media expertise
    • Collaborate on negotiation strategies by building strong relationships with content and digital publishers
    • Help to set overall objectives and corresponding benchmarks for each campaign
    • Steward smooth and timely campaign launch and execution thanks to a sharp attention to detail throughout the execution process.
  • Manage project execution from start to finish, including integrated sponsorships and content creation across linear, digital, social and creator
    • Drive the creative and production process with a clear understanding of all aspects of content promotion and development, including legal contracting. Help deliver efficient and outstanding programs.
  • Understand the content & digital landscape and adopt new media trends from a publisher, audience and category perspective if relevant to clients' objectives
  • Marketplace facing - build relationships and understand landscape across content and digital partners
  • Build, maintain and grow client relationships, in support of the team
  • Contribute to client presentations and lead management of deliverables and communications especially as it pertains to content and creator campaigns
  • Understand and articulate client category expertise and knowledge of the competitive landscape
  • Use effective coordination and leadership capabilities and a collaborative approach to work with IAT, including media and creative teams. This helps deliver complete strategies for the brands.
  • Knowledge-sharing with all team members to guarantee that PMX & Zenith solutions, tools, guidelines and processes are used and applied across the brands they manage

Qualifications
  • Must have 3+ years of experience in integrated marketing, content strategy and execution; Agency side experience highly preferred
  • Knowledge of content strategy, brand marketing and production across media platforms
  • Knowledge and experience with content, content strategy, brand marketing, production, digital, and social landscape
  • Creative thinker with strength in digital and social content marketing - knowledge and experience in Influencer marketing Strong project management skills including organization, attention to detail, and ability to multi-task
  • Ability to adjust, self-direct and move projects forward in an independent and focused approach
  • Strong client service skills, flexibility, standout colleague - client focused service mentality
  • Ability to work both independently and as a member of a focused team of professionals
  • Ability to collaborate and lead meetings with a variety of partners
  • Excellent internal and external communication and presentation skills - storytelling key
  • Understanding of available content marketing metrics and marketplace trends in content
  • Strong knowledge of the Microsoft Suite; Google docs, NetBase/social listening tools, Prisma
